In the realm of vampire romance novels, a fascinating mix of themes has emerged that speaks to both timeless tropes and modern sensibilities. One notable trend is the exploration of consent and agency in relationships. Gone are the days of the brooding vampire who simply takes what he wants; contemporary novels often delve into the complexities of consent, emphasizing mutual attraction and partnerships built on respect. This not only reflects societal shifts but also adds depth to characters, allowing readers to connect more intimately with their journeys.
Another captivating theme is the blending of supernatural elements with real-world issues. For instance, we see vampires dealing with contemporary social issues, such as identity, belonging, and even environmental concerns. Such narratives often liken vampires to marginalized groups, allowing authors to explore themes of acceptance and prejudice in a unique, metaphorical way. It’s exhilarating how these novels serve as both escapism and a mirror reflecting some of our most pressing societal challenges.
Additionally, many new stories are embracing humor and light-heartedness. Some authors have taken a whimsical approach, crafting romantic tales that often poke fun at classic vampire tropes, introducing quirky characters and situations that keep readers laughing. This playful twist has widened the audience, attracting those who might not otherwise delve into traditional gothic romance. You know what's interesting? How many of these books use the supernatural to explore themes of consent and boundaries in a very literal way. A vampire must control their hunger. A werewolf must manage their temper during the moon. A siren must be careful with their voice. The romance develops alongside the love interest's rigorous self-control and the protagonist's trust in that control.
This creates a foundation of respect that is incredibly appealing. The supernatural danger isn't glossed over; it's a central part of their dynamic that they navigate together with communication and care. It models a very conscious, respectful relationship where power imbalances are acknowledged and actively managed.
